Output 6a5626a400065e1c9c741cc331e0ec4c94c9d76d892867eeef5ddc1b6ab68a25:0

value
1309490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15166b1f13c4d5a8393b2e619ab4febdece75a9f OP_EQUAL
address
33cWyETnTNz7nb6qc4TeoDNqbMeatKn81F
transaction
6a5626a400065e1c9c741cc331e0ec4c94c9d76d892867eeef5ddc1b6ab68a25
confirmations
176036
spent
true